Assistant Community Manager

The Assistant Community Manager is responsible for assisting in all the Community Manager's operational duties, including reporting, rent processing, leasing and marketing, and overseeing the community and community staff in the Community Manager’s absence.

Essential Job Functions:

Assists with daily and month-end reporting including accurate reporting on resident ledgers. Responsible for posting rent, collection on delinquency, the eviction process, creating/posting POs, and daily deposits. Secures and manages lease renewals and prepares new lease paperwork for final approval. Physically walk and inspect community daily addressing any issues and verifying property conditions meet Company standard. Assist in hiring and training of new team members as needed. Monitors resident satisfaction through various methods of communication. Develops and maintains knowledge of the property and competitors in the area. Oversees property operations and staff in Community Manager’s absence. Assist with leasing job duties, including touring prospective residents and preparation of lease agreements, as directed to meet business need.

Minimum Qualifications/Skills:

High School diploma or GED Strong marketing background Basic computer technology skills and basic knowledge of MS Office Suite Effective oral and written communication skills Ability to work with a diverse group of people in a collaborative setting. Ability to handle multiple projects and thrive in a fast-paced, competitive environment.

Desired Qualifications/Skills:  

Previous bookkeeping/account reconciliation experience Previous property management industry experience CAM/Licensed Property Manager certification Knowledge of Yardi Voyager Valid driver’s license may be required.

Work Schedule: Generally, 9am-6pm, Monday-Friday; additional hours, including weekends, will be required to meet business needs.
